Transaction c8500a14cb366bc4ac64b1606986527dcdff37ff9fc3b68283230290fa536e7b
1 Input
1 Output
-
c8500a14cb366bc4ac64b1606986527dcdff37ff9fc3b68283230290fa536e7b:0
- value
- 145708302
- script pubkey
- OP_0 OP_PUSHBYTES_20 78b5094afa46b3ff6abc0e120aea9ce459f9595c
- address
- bc1q0z6sjjh6g6el764upcfq465uu3vljk2uwgcjd2